The birth of Jenessa McMillen

Jenessa Fayerose McMillen was born on August 16, 1993 in Stanislaus County, California.

Her father's last name is McMillen, and her mother's maiden name is Peters. If Jenessa is still alive, she's now years old.

Her potential siblings include Robert (born 1968) and Jonathan (born 1989).

Name Jenessa Fayerose McMillen
Sex female
Birthdate 08/16/1993
Birthplace Stanislaus County, California
Mother's Maiden Name Peters
Contact